Men as the Victim of Patriarchal System in Ocean Vuong's on Earth We're Briefly Gorgeous (2018).
Skripsi thesis, Universitas Negeri Padang.
Abstract
This study discusses the expectations of the patriarchal system for men which lead to men as victims of the patriarchal system, which is usually known as a system that is very detrimental to women in Ocean Vuong's “On Earth We're Briefly Gorgeous” that was released in 2018. This research was written using descriptive research method, which is the method used to describe in detail a phenomenon or issue in a literary work. This study provides 2 findings. The first finding is men can become victims of the patriarchal system because some men cannot meet the patriarchal system standards that require men to be masculine, physically and mentally strong, and also be heterosexual. The second finding is, through this research, it is known that Ocean Vuong's "On Earth We're Briefly Gorgeous" (2018) portrays men as victims of the patriarchal system through the main character, Little Dog, and through several events in the novel which are explained through several excerpts.
